Chteau De Coucy

The Chteau de Coucy is a French castle in the commune of Coucy Le Chteau Auffrique, in the dpartement of Aisne, built in the 13th century and renovated by Viollet le Duc in the 19th. In 1917, it was severely damaged by German artillery fire. Its dungeon was the largest in Europe, measuring 35 meters wide and 55 meters long. Coucy
